| Description | (1R,3S,5R,7R,8R,9R,10R,15R)-15-[(3R)-2,2-dimethyl-5-oxooxolan-3-yl]-7-[(2R)-2-hydroxy-5-oxo-2,5-dihydrofuran-3-yl]-8,15-dimethyl-2-methylidene-12-oxo-4,11-dioxatetracyclo[8.5.0.0³,⁵.0³,⁸]Pentadec-13-en-9-yl acetate belongs to the class of organic compounds known as tetracarboxylic acids and derivatives. These are carboxylic acids containing exactly four carboxyl groups. (1r,3s,5r,7r,8r,9r,10r,15r)-15-[(3r)-2,2-dimethyl-5-oxooxolan-3-yl]-7-[(2r)-2-hydroxy-5-oxo-2h-furan-3-yl]-8,15-dimethyl-2-methylidene-12-oxo-4,11-dioxatetracyclo[8.5.0.0³,⁵.0³,⁸]pentadec-13-en-9-yl acetate is found in Munronia pinnata.
